visje Posté(e) 23 février 2010 Share Posté(e) 23 février 2010 Bonjour à tous. Nouveau dans le monde Android j'ai décidé de me lancer dans du développement pour cette plate-forme très prometteuse. J'ai installé tout le nécéssaire et j'ai réussit à coder un bon vieux "Hello World !" grâce au tuto officiel. Mais ca s'arrête là ... j'essayes de trouver une doc complète pour Android, ou bien des petits tuto pas trop dur et je trouve pas grand chose :mad: Pouvez vous donc m'indiquer où aller chercher pour commencer à coder de véritables applis ou des tutos ? Merci beaucoup :) Citer Lien vers le commentaire Partager sur d’autres sites More sharing options...
commarla Posté(e) 23 février 2010 Share Posté(e) 23 février 2010 (modifié) Salut, As tu fais le "notepad tutorial" http://developer.android.com/resources/tutorials/notepad/index.html Comme ça tu verras les intent, la base sqlite, etc. Ensuite dans le SDK ou ici tu as plein d'exemples. A+ Modifié 23 février 2010 par commarla Citer Lien vers le commentaire Partager sur d’autres sites More sharing options...
visje Posté(e) 23 février 2010 Auteur Share Posté(e) 23 février 2010 Merci pour ta réponse. Je vais voir tout ca :) Citer Lien vers le commentaire Partager sur d’autres sites More sharing options...
Pierre87 Posté(e) 23 février 2010 Share Posté(e) 23 février 2010 Le plus dur (pour moi) c'est de savoir QUOI coder ! Citer Lien vers le commentaire Partager sur d’autres sites More sharing options...
daarksim Posté(e) 23 février 2010 Share Posté(e) 23 février 2010 Si tu veux pierre87 j'ai plein d'idées :p Citer Lien vers le commentaire Partager sur d’autres sites More sharing options...
Pierre87 Posté(e) 23 février 2010 Share Posté(e) 23 février 2010 dis toujours :P mais je fais que des trucs qui puissent m'être utile genre une application pour connaitre son cycle menstruel, je m'en tape Citer Lien vers le commentaire Partager sur d’autres sites More sharing options...
Zephiros Posté(e) 23 février 2010 Share Posté(e) 23 février 2010 dis toujours :Pmais je fais que des trucs qui puissent m'être utile genre une application pour connaitre son cycle menstruel, je m'en tape Tu déconnes? Admettons que ta gonzesse veut un gosse et qu'elle fait exprès de pas prendre la pilule. Et bien avec ta super application de suivi de cycle mentruel et bah tac ! Tu sais quand il faut rien faire... :p Citer Lien vers le commentaire Partager sur d’autres sites More sharing options...
Profete162 Posté(e) 23 février 2010 Share Posté(e) 23 février 2010 Le plus dur (pour moi) c'est de savoir QUOI coder ! Les idées que j'avais mis de côté: - Une appli pour faciliter la désinstallation des apps - Une appli permettant de changer plus facilement la langue que toggle locale ( genre tu en mets 2 ou 3 en favori et ca le fait) - Tu peux m'aider à developper un Chalky open source -etc... Citer Lien vers le commentaire Partager sur d’autres sites More sharing options...
Pierre87 Posté(e) 23 février 2010 Share Posté(e) 23 février 2010 @Zephiros : j'ai pas de copine >.< @Profete162 Quick Uninstaller La langue, ça me sert pas, car sur le Nexus One il y a pleins de langues accessibles Truc de sadique ton chalky :D ça me plait bien, mais je n'ai malheureusement pas (actuellement) les connaissances suffisantes en "physique" pour faire ça Citer Lien vers le commentaire Partager sur d’autres sites More sharing options...
Profete162 Posté(e) 23 février 2010 Share Posté(e) 23 février 2010 Truc de sadique ton chalky :D ça me plait bien, mais je n'ai malheureusement pas (actuellement) les connaissances suffisantes en "physique" pour faire ça Si je te dis que J'ai les connaissances en physique mais pas en developpement, on se lance? En fait j'ai commencé doucement et j'en suis à ce stade là: https://www.frandroid.com/forum/viewtopic.php?id=7987 apres, suffit de rajouter une seconde "bille", la lier, une 3eme, etc... Citer Lien vers le commentaire Partager sur d’autres sites More sharing options...
Pierre87 Posté(e) 23 février 2010 Share Posté(e) 23 février 2010 ouais faut voir ^^ Tu peux voir ce que je sais faire au travers de mes 2 apps dans ma signature. Mais tu t'y connais vraiment en "physique de jeu" ? physique et animation indépendante du nombre de FPS ... (un peu mon point faible, mais je pense y arriver) Tu peux me contacter par mail/gtalk/msn, c'est le mail donnée sur le forum Citer Lien vers le commentaire Partager sur d’autres sites More sharing options...
Toros Posté(e) 23 février 2010 Share Posté(e) 23 février 2010 Une app pour se servir de la méssagerie Steam ^^ Un widget 1x1 : qui en un clic te note une position (genre je gare ma voiture, je clic... et quand j'ouvre map je peux voir ou j'avais laissé ma caisse) Citer Lien vers le commentaire Partager sur d’autres sites More sharing options...
Pierre87 Posté(e) 23 février 2010 Share Posté(e) 23 février 2010 steam c'est un protocole fermé ^^ pas con ton truc de localisation ! mais ça doit dejà exister et ça va être très dur à tester pour moi :x Citer Lien vers le commentaire Partager sur d’autres sites More sharing options...
visje Posté(e) 24 février 2010 Auteur Share Posté(e) 24 février 2010 Salut,As tu fais le "notepad tutorial" http://developer.android.com/resources/ … index.html Comme ça tu verras les intent, la base sqlite, etc. Ensuite dans le SDK ou ici tu as plein d'exemples. En fait, c'est cool mais le problème c'est que c'est pas vraiment des tutos :s ... c'est plus du "tu colles ca, ca te donnes ca" ... J'ai lu en gros les "fundamentals" pour comprendre comment ca marche mais c'est pas facile aussi de tout retenir, et le tuto sur Notepad est pas vraiment fait pour "apprendre"... :/ N'y aurait-il pas des tutos plus simple (comme "Hello World !" ou bien des tutos à tâche unique). Merci :) Citer Lien vers le commentaire Partager sur d’autres sites More sharing options...
Pierre87 Posté(e) 24 février 2010 Share Posté(e) 24 février 2010 Des petites astuces ici : http://android.cyrilmottier.com/ Mais rien de tel que faire un projet "à toi" pour comprendre comment ça marche ! Citer Lien vers le commentaire Partager sur d’autres sites More sharing options...
Leimi Posté(e) 24 février 2010 Share Posté(e) 24 février 2010 Hello, Les articles d'E-vidence.net sont très bien pour débuter :) Citer Lien vers le commentaire Partager sur d’autres sites More sharing options...
mSm Posté(e) 24 février 2010 Share Posté(e) 24 février 2010 Je m'y lancerais bien également, les petits tutos débutant sont encore difficile à trouver. On peu peut être créé un topic (celui-ci par exemple) qui référence divers tutos et aides pour le développement sur android? Citer Lien vers le commentaire Partager sur d’autres sites More sharing options...
visje Posté(e) 24 février 2010 Auteur Share Posté(e) 24 février 2010 Merci à vous. C'est vrai qu'il n'ya pas de topic spécifique pour des tuto ou pour apprendre à utiliser le "moteur" Android. Ca serait super qu'il yen ai un Citer Lien vers le commentaire Partager sur d’autres sites More sharing options...
Pierre87 Posté(e) 24 février 2010 Share Posté(e) 24 février 2010 Quel moteur ? Si tu lis la doc officielle dans l'ordre, ça suffit pour comprendre pas mal de trucs ! C'est vrai qu'elle n'est pas très didactique, mais on y trouve plein de chose. Après, tout est dispo sur internet. Il suffit de chercher sur google quand t'as un problème :P Citer Lien vers le commentaire Partager sur d’autres sites More sharing options...
Prydwen Posté(e) 25 février 2010 Share Posté(e) 25 février 2010 (modifié) Je n'y connais rien, mais ça me passionnerait d'apprendre à développer. Merci pour ce topic Visje ! Je me penche pour l'instant sur le guide d'Android, je viens d'installer le SDK. Par contre ils disent de modifier le Path dans "poste de travail", j'en ignore l'utilité mais j'ai peur de faire une connerie ; ça ne risque pas de me planter quelque chose si je remplace C:\Windows\system.... par l'emplacement du fichier Tools ? Ai-je bien compris ? (Question subsidiaire : faut-il être un pro en info pour apprendre à développer ? Sachant que je n'ai pas comme ambition de publier une appli un jour, juste de m'instruire et de comprendre un peu comment tout cela fonctionne :) ) J'en suis au codage de 'Hello World', MAIS : quand, dans le code, je tape TextView, rien ne se passe, comme si le mot n'était pas reconnu ; il ne change pas de couleur (désolée pour le vocabulaire de noob). Any idea ? Modifié 25 février 2010 par Prydwen Citer Lien vers le commentaire Partager sur d’autres sites More sharing options...
Pierre87 Posté(e) 25 février 2010 Share Posté(e) 25 février 2010 Non! Remplaces pas C:\Windows\System ! http://www.redfernplace.com/software-projects/patheditor/ Un joli editeur de path graphique \o/ Le path, c'est une liste de dossier, où ton OS va chercher des exécutable (par exemple "adb") Avant, pour accéder à adb, tu devais faire : "C:\android-sdk\tools\adb.exe" Maitenant, juste : "adb" Car Windows va chercher "adb" dans tout les dossier du path. C'est très utile. Pour utiliser path editor, "add directory", puis tu choisi le dossier "tools" du sdk "save to registry" et tu redémarres les applications concernées Le truc dans poste de travail, ça fait la même chose, sauf que les dossiers de "path" sont séparés par des ";" Pas forcément besoin d'être pro, il faut juste de la logique, et de la persévérance :] Comme tu sembles débuter, et que les apps Android sont en java : http://www.siteduzero.com/tutoriel-3-10601-programmation-en-java.html Tu peux faire les parties 1 et 2 : Bien commencer en Java Java Orienté Objet La partie "graphique" de java (swing, awt, applet), tu t'en fiches, car ça ne concerne pas Android Pour ton problème de TextView, ça dépend où tu l'écris ... Regardes si tu n'as pas d'erreurs... (souligné en rouge) Au pire, tu nous colles ton code Citer Lien vers le commentaire Partager sur d’autres sites More sharing options...
Prydwen Posté(e) 25 février 2010 Share Posté(e) 25 février 2010 Merci beaucoup Pierre, toujours à ma rescousse :D J'ai installé Path editor et ajouté le dossier tools, mais je ne dois pas configurer le "mot clé" ? Si je suis dans la boite de commandes (whats the name for it???), comment savoir quel mot taper pour utiliser ce "raccourci" ? Merci beaucoup pour les liens sur Java, je vais faire tout ça avant Android alors :) Ca devrait m'occuper un moment ! J'espère que mon netbook tiendra le coup.. Pour "TextView", voici le screen du code D'après le tuto, TextView devrait apparaître en couleurs, sauf que non. Et si je lance le code, l'écran reste sur la page d'accueil "Android" Citer Lien vers le commentaire Partager sur d’autres sites More sharing options...
Pierre87 Posté(e) 25 février 2010 Share Posté(e) 25 février 2010 "Ligne de commande" ou "cmd" (plus court), ça fait l'affaire Pas besoin de mot clé. Si tu tapes "adb", Windows va aller chercher tout seul dans les dossiers du path (dans l'ordre) s'il trouve un fichier adb.exe Pareil pour fastboot... Pour ton code .... Je ne vois pas trop ce que tu veux faire en fait :s Ca me parait correct, mais il m'en faudrait plus pour pouvoir t'aider :P Par exemple, la totalité de ta classe HelloAndroid2, ton fichier de layout "main.xml", et aussi le contenu de ton fichier Manifest (le dernier onglet permet d'avoir le code xml). Tu peux coller le code sur le forum avec la balise "code" (clic sur le bouton au dessus qui ressemble à ça <--->) Mais si tu ne veux pas embêter les autres avec tes questions (et polluer le topic) , tu peux toujours me poser des questions par mail. Citer Lien vers le commentaire Partager sur d’autres sites More sharing options...
Prydwen Posté(e) 25 février 2010 Share Posté(e) 25 février 2010 Message reçu, je déguerpis :) Citer Lien vers le commentaire Partager sur d’autres sites More sharing options...
visje Posté(e) 25 février 2010 Auteur Share Posté(e) 25 février 2010 si tu veut débuter, je recommande très fortemment cet article http://www.e-vidence.net/?p=112 recommandé par Leimi plus haut (que je remercie :) ) c'est vraiment très bien fait comme tuto et simple a comprendre. Citer Lien vers le commentaire Partager sur d’autres sites More sharing options...
Recommended Posts
Rejoignez la conversation
Vous pouvez poster maintenant et vous enregistrez plus tard. Si vous avez un compte, connectez-vous maintenant pour poster.